#153fa8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#153fa8 is composed of 8.2% red, 24.7%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.5%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 37.1%. #153fa8 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a7eff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#153fa8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#153fa8 has RGB values of R:21, G:63,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 1392552.

Hex triplet 153fa8 #153fa8
RGB Decimal 21, 63, 168 rgb(21,63,168)
RGB Percent 8.2, 24.7, 65.9 rgb(8.2%,24.7%,65.9%)
CMYK 88, 63, 0, 34
HSL 222.9°, 77.8, 37.1 hsl(222.9,77.8%,37.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 222.9°, 87.5, 65.9
Web Safe 003399 #003399
CIE-LAB 30.738, 27.725, -60.011
XYZ 9.153, 6.541, 37.824
xyY 0.171, 0.122, 6.541
CIE-LCH 30.738, 66.106, 294.797
CIE-LUV 30.738, -12.777, -80.578
Hunter-Lab 25.575, 19.127, -69.783
Binary 00010101, 00111111, 10101000

Shades and Tints of #153fa8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040b is the darkest color, while #f9f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#153fa8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5e5f is the less saturated color, while #0639b7 is the most saturated one.
